The volume of a nations annual production, Smith asserted, will depend primarily on the skill, dexterity, and judgment with which people apply their labor to the natural resources available to them, and this in turn will depend primarily upon the extent to which they have carried the division of labor, or what we would call specialization. He saw that the wealth-producing activities of a commercial society are coordinated through movements in the relative prices of goods, both outputs and inputs. But specialization requires trade, so that when the division of labor has extended itself sufficiently throughout a society, everyone lives by exchanging.
